编程的课堂互动游戏是什么
-
编程的课堂互动游戏是一种教学方法,通过结合编程和游戏的元素,激发学生的学习兴趣,提高编程能力。这种教学方法可以使学生在轻松愉快的游戏环境中学习编程知识和技能,同时也可以培养学生的逻辑思维、问题解决能力和团队合作精神。
编程的课堂互动游戏通常采用图形化编程工具,如Scratch、Blockly等,让学生通过拖拽、连接图形积木的方式编写程序。通过这种方式,学生可以快速上手,理解编程的基本概念和逻辑结构,避免了繁琐的语法学习,降低了学习门槛。
在编程的课堂互动游戏中,学生通常需要完成一系列任务或解决问题,通过编写程序来达到预期目标。这些任务或问题往往与游戏情节相关,如控制角色移动、收集物品、打败敌人等。通过完成任务,学生可以获得游戏内的奖励或解锁新关卡,激发学生的竞争心理和学习动力。
编程的课堂互动游戏还可以设置多人合作模式,学生可以分组合作,共同解决问题或完成任务。这样可以培养学生的团队合作能力、沟通能力和领导能力,提高学生的综合素质。
总而言之,编程的课堂互动游戏是一种创新的教学方法,通过结合编程和游戏的元素,激发学生的学习兴趣,提高编程能力,培养学生的逻辑思维、问题解决能力和团队合作精神。这种教学方法在教学实践中取得了良好的效果,被广泛应用于编程教育领域。
1年前 -
编程的课堂互动游戏是一种教学方法,旨在通过游戏化的方式来增强学生的参与度和学习动力。这些游戏通常结合了编程的基本概念和技能,让学生在实践中学习和应用编程知识。
以下是关于编程的课堂互动游戏的五个要点:
-
游戏化学习体验:编程的课堂互动游戏将学习过程转化为一种有趣、具有挑战性的游戏体验。学生可以通过完成任务、解决问题和赢得游戏来激发他们的兴趣和动力。这种游戏化的学习方式可以帮助学生更好地理解和掌握编程的基本概念。
-
实践和应用编程知识:编程的课堂互动游戏通过让学生亲自编写代码和解决编程问题来帮助他们实践和应用所学的编程知识。学生可以在游戏中创建和控制角色、设计和构建游戏场景、编写算法和逻辑等。这种实践性的学习方式可以帮助学生更好地理解编程的实际应用。
-
团队合作和竞争:编程的课堂互动游戏通常可以支持多人游戏,鼓励学生在团队中合作解决问题或在竞争中展示他们的技能。学生可以分工合作,互相交流和分享编程思路,共同完成游戏任务。这种团队合作和竞争的学习方式可以培养学生的合作精神、沟通能力和竞争意识。
-
错误和反馈机制:编程的课堂互动游戏通常会提供错误和反馈机制,帮助学生在编程过程中发现和纠正错误。学生可以通过试错和调试来改进他们的代码,从而更好地理解编程的概念和技巧。这种错误和反馈机制可以培养学生的问题解决能力和逻辑思维能力。
-
个性化学习路径:编程的课堂互动游戏通常会根据学生的学习进度和能力水平提供个性化的学习路径和挑战。学生可以根据自己的兴趣和需求选择不同的游戏关卡或任务,以适应他们的学习需求。这种个性化的学习方式可以激发学生的自主学习能力和创造力。
编程的课堂互动游戏是一种创新的教学方法,通过游戏化的学习体验帮助学生更好地理解和应用编程知识。它可以提高学生的学习动力和参与度,培养他们的问题解决能力和创造力。同时,它也可以促进学生的团队合作和竞争意识,培养他们的沟通能力和合作精神。
1年前 -
-
编程的课堂互动游戏是指在编程教学中,通过游戏化的方式来增强学生的参与度和学习兴趣,提高编程技能的一种教学方法。这种游戏通常结合了编程任务、挑战和竞争等元素,让学生在解决问题和完成任务的过程中,通过编程来控制游戏的发展和结果,从而锻炼他们的逻辑思维和编程能力。
编程的课堂互动游戏可以有很多种形式,下面将介绍几种常见的游戏形式和操作流程:
- 编程迷宫游戏
编程迷宫游戏是一种通过编程指令来控制角色在迷宫中移动的游戏。学生需要使用编程语言或者图形化编程工具,编写指令让角色按照特定的路径走到终点。这种游戏可以帮助学生理解编程中的控制结构和算法逻辑。
操作流程:
- 学生通过编程语言或者图形化编程工具创建一个角色,并设计一个迷宫地图;
- 学生编写相应的指令,控制角色在迷宫中移动;
- 学生测试程序,观察角色是否按照预期的路径移动;
- 学生根据测试结果进行调试和优化,直到角色成功抵达终点。
- 编程解谜游戏
编程解谜游戏是一种通过编程来解决谜题的游戏。学生需要根据提示和问题,使用编程语言或者图形化编程工具,编写程序来解决谜题。这种游戏可以培养学生的问题解决能力和创造力。
操作流程:
- 学生阅读谜题的描述和提示,理解问题的要求;
- 学生使用编程语言或者图形化编程工具,编写相应的程序来解决问题;
- 学生测试程序,观察是否满足谜题的要求;
- 学生根据测试结果进行调试和优化,直到解决谜题。
- 编程竞赛游戏
编程竞赛游戏是一种通过编程来进行竞争的游戏。学生可以在规定的时间内,使用编程语言或者图形化编程工具,编写程序来完成指定的任务。这种游戏可以培养学生的快速思维和应对压力的能力。
操作流程:
- 学生阅读竞赛规则和任务要求,理解任务的目标;
- 学生使用编程语言或者图形化编程工具,尽快编写程序来完成任务;
- 学生测试程序,观察是否满足任务的要求;
- 学生根据测试结果进行调试和优化,直到完成任务。
以上是编程的课堂互动游戏的几种常见形式和操作流程,通过这些游戏,学生可以在实践中学习编程技能,提高解决问题的能力,并且增加学习的趣味性和动力。
1年前 - 编程迷宫游戏